<p>Micheal Pachter feels that Sony&#8217;s pricing of the move controllers could be confusing to consumers.</p>
<p>In a post-E3 analysis Pachter <a target="_blank" href="http://www.mcvuk.com/features/709/Pachters-E3-Analysis" target="_blank">said </a>“Some games can be played with the PlayStation Eye camera and a Move controller, some with the Eye and two Move controllers, and some with the Eye, a Move controller and a Navigation controller.”</p>
<p>“In order to be safe, consumers wishing to participate in the Move experience will have to purchase the Eye, two Move controllers and the Navigation controller, plus a game. If purchased as part of a bundle, the all-in cost to play with Move will approach $180, which we think is beyond the reach of the typical household.”</p>
<p>“We think that Sony’s Move is truly impressive, but remain concerned that initial sales could disappoint.”</p>
<p>Move will launch in North America on September 19.</p>

			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p style="text-align: left;"><a href="http://daxgamer.com/wp-content/uploads/2010/02/playstation-3-ps3.jpg"><img class="aligncenter size-full wp-image-1385" title="playstation-3-ps3" src="http://daxgamer.com/wp-content/uploads/2010/02/playstation-3-ps3-e1276655644657.jpg" alt="playstation 3 ps3 e1276655644657 Playstation Move Coming In September" width="630" height="342" /></a>Sony has officially set a date and price for their motion controller. PlayStation move will launch on  September 19  in the US, September 15  in Europe and October 21st in Japan.</p>
<p style="text-align: left;">The PlayStaiton Move controller will cost $49.99, with the subcontroller comming in at $29.99. There’ll also be a bundle featuring the PSEye camera, a Move controller and Sports Champions game for $99.99. There’ll also be a PS3 Slim bundle, with the console, the Move controller, PSEye and Sports Champions for $399.99.</p>
<p style="text-align: left;">First party PlayStation Move games will be priced at $39.99.</p>

			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p><a href="http://daxgamer.com/wp-content/uploads/2010/02/playstation-3-ps3.jpg"><img class="aligncenter size-full wp-image-1385" title="playstation-3-ps3" src="http://daxgamer.com/wp-content/uploads/2010/02/playstation-3-ps3.jpg" alt="playstation 3 ps3 Cross game party chat coming to PS3, Playstation Plus Details " width="626" height="340" /></a>Cross-game chat is coming to the PlayStation Network. It allows PSN members to talk to each other, even while playing different games. The downside is that you have to be a PlayStation Plus member to use it.</p>
<p>PlayStation+ members will be able to send invites to any four members of the PlayStation Network, however at least one person must be a member of PSN+.</p>
<blockquote><p>Sony Computer Entertainment Inc. today announced that it will offer PlayStation®Plus, a new subscription service package on PlayStation®Network. In addition to the current free to use existing features and services, PlayStation Plus brings value-added offerings including exclusive services and content on June 29, 2010, worldwide. PlayStation Plus will further enhance PlayStation Network, which has recently achieved a cumulative number of registered accounts of over 50 million globally.</p>
<p>By accessing PlayStation®Store via PlayStation®3 (PS3®), PlayStation Network users will be able to purchase membership*1 to PlayStation Plus, providing members with new options to expand and enhance their gaming experience and enabling them to gain an exclusive set of features and content. For users’ convenience, PlayStation Plus will be available in different subscription options of 30 days (Japan: 500 yen, Asia: HK$38), 90 days (North America: $17.99, Europe: €14.99) and 365 days (Japan: 5,000 yen, Asia: HK$233, North America: $49.99, Europe: €49.99).</p>
<p>PlayStation Plus will be available on June 29, 2010 for a 365-day package at $49.99. SCEA is also running a “limited time offer” giving subscribers 3 free bonus months for signing up for a 365-day subscription. Consumers also have the option to subscribe for 90-days for $17.99.</p>
<p>PlayStation Plus features include*2:</p>
<p><strong>Full game trial*3</strong></p>
<p>Members will have access to full versions of designated PS3® and PlayStation Network titles including PS one® Archives (PS one® Classics). The titles on offer will be available for download on PlayStation Store for a stated period and change every month. Members will be able to play the full version of the game for a designated period and even after the trial period expires, users will be able to continue playing the game by purchasing the game on-line*4.</p>
<p><strong>Games</strong></p>
<p>Member will be able to play the full version of designated PS3 downloadable and PlayStation Network titles including PS one Archives (PS one Classics) and minis*5 with no limit of time as long as membership is effective. These games will become available exclusively for PlayStation Plus members at no extra cost.</p>
<p><strong>Special content</strong></p>
<p>Content such as avatars and custom themes many of which are exclusive will become available for PlayStation Plus members at no extra cost.</p>
<p><strong>Discounts</strong></p>
<p>Members will have access to exclusive discounts on designated PS3 and PSP® (PlayStation®Portable) titles. Titles will vary every month on PlayStation Store.</p>
<p><strong>Early access</strong></p>
<p>Members will have early access to designated new game beta trials, game demos and video content prior to public distribution.</p>
<p><strong>Automatic content downloads and updates</strong></p>
<p>PS3 will automatically download and install designated game demos and game updates and also download the system software update data*6. PS3 will automatically start up at a designated time to download content and will turn off after the download has completed.</p>
<p>*1 PlayStation users can purchase PlayStation Plus membership through PlayStation Store on PS3 only. Users need to install PS3 system software version 3.40, which will be released on June 22nd, to enjoy PlayStation Plus.<br />
*2 Content will vary by region.<br />
*3 Expiration date will vary by content.<br />
*4 Users will continue to enjoy games with previously saved data. Any trophies earned during the trial will also be unlocked.<br />
*5 “minis” are not available in Japan.<br />
*6 As the install requires users agreement, it will not be installed automatically.</p></blockquote>

<p>It seems Mad Catz already has a few Kinect accessors lined up.</p>
<blockquote><p>Mad Catz ® Interactive, Inc. (Mad Catz or the Company) (AMEX/TSX: MCZ), a leading third-party interactive entertainment accessory provider, today announced a new range of accessories compatible with Kinect for Microsoft Xbox 360 (<em>formally known as Project Natal</em>). The accessories are expected to ship world-wide alongside the official launch of Kinect, expected November 2010.</p>
<p>The new range of accessories will focus on offering gamers a multitude of options in the placement and positioning of the camera unit hardware, essential to enjoying the new entertainment experiences promised by Kinect.</p>
<p>Products expected to launch as part of the range are as follows:</p>
<p>· <strong>Mad Catz Base Adapter for Xbox 360 Kinect</strong></p>
<p>Ideal for those who have no obvious free standing space available to mount the Kinect camera unit, the <strong>Base Adapter</strong> fits securely on to the underside of the camera unit, allowing connection to any standard camera tripod. Simple, yet ingenious, the <strong>Base Adapter </strong>provides a cost effective and elegant solution to those with custom TV installations.</p>
<p><em>MSRP: $14.99</em></p>
<p>· <strong>Mad Catz Floor Stand for Xbox 360 Kinect</strong></p>
<p>For those who don’t wish to permanently mount their Kinect camera unit, or for those who have no obvious space available, the <strong>Floor Stand</strong> includes a stable, weighted base, a 2.5ft central mounting pole and an in-built Base Adapter, providing an all-in-one solution for mounting and enjoying the Kinect system.</p>
<p><em>MSRP: $29.99</em></p>
<p>· <strong>Mad Catz Flat Panel Mounting Bracket for Xbox 360 Kinect</strong></p>
<p>An ideal and elegant solution to those with flat panel televisions, the <strong>Flat Panel Mounting Bracket </strong>allows users to safely mount their camera unit above or below their television sets, sitting into a custom bracket which connects to most standard screw holes located on the rear of standard flat panel televisions. Compatible with the majority of existing television wall-mount brackets, the <strong>Flat Panel Mounting Bracket</strong> features an innovative “pass-thru” design, allows users to connect to pre-existing TV wall-mounts or simply by itself should users display their in a free standing position. Featuring a solid, durable metal construction, and complete with all standard fittings, the adjustable design ensures compatibility with a wide variety of TV makes, models and sizes (<em>please check compatibility before purchase</em>).</p>
<p><em>MSRP: $49.99</em></p>
<p>Darren Richardson, President and Chief Executive Officer of Mad Catz commented, “The new range of accessories we are announcing today will allow a wide audience to enjoy the new entertainment possibilities promised by the Kinect system, and we are delighted to be able to support this new technology from day one with a range of affordable and innovative mounting solutions.”</p></blockquote>
